The Outer Shell - Stainless Steel Brilliance

The outer shell of electric kettles is commonly crafted from stainless steel, a versatile material cherished for its durability, corrosion resistance, and sleek aesthetic. Stainless steel not only lends a modern and stylish appearance to kettles but also ensures they withstand the rigors of daily use.

 

The Crucial Heating Element - Aluminum's Efficiency

At the heart of every electric kettle lies the heating element, a critical component responsible for transforming electrical energy into heat. Frequently, these elements are composed of aluminum, a material renowned for its exceptional heat conductivity and efficiency.

The advantages of aluminum as the heating element in a kettle lie in its excellent thermal conductivity, allowing for rapid and even heating of water, enabling the electric kettle to quickly reach boiling point upon activation. Aluminum is lightweight, corrosion-resistant, ensuring the kettle's stability during prolonged use, and is a cost-effective option, contributing to competitive manufacturing costs for electric kettles.

 

The Insulating Handle - Cool to the Touch

To ensure user safety, electric kettles feature handles made from insulating materials such as heat-resistant plastic or rubber. These materials are carefully chosen to prevent the transfer of heat from the boiling water to the handle, allowing users to comfortably and safely pour their hot beverages.

 

Water Level Line - Safety design

The main purpose of the stainless steel kettle's water level line is to assist users in accurately measuring and controlling the amount of water added. Typically located inside the kettle, the water level line indicates different water levels, such as the minimum and maximum levels. By observing the water level line, users can ensure that the amount of water added suits their needs, avoiding overfilling or insufficient water, thereby ensuring the normal operation and safe use of the kettle.

Furthermore, the water level line helps prevent water overflow during heating, as users can precisely determine when to stop adding water. This is crucial for preventing the kettle from overheating or causing other safety issues. Therefore, the water level line, while providing convenience, is also an important safety design.

 

The Base - A Platform for Innovation

The base of electric kettles, where the thermostat is often housed, is typically made from durable materials like plastic or stainless steel. Some advanced models include innovative features such as 360-degree rotational bases, enhancing user convenience and flexibility.
